What companies run services between Newark, NJ, USA and Demarest, NJ, USA?

NJ Transit operates a train from Frank R Lautenberg Secaucus Lower Level to Oradell hourly. Tickets cost $2–12 and the journey takes 31 min.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Newark Penn Station to Washington Ave At Massachusetts Ave via Port Authority Bus Terminal in around 1h 36m.
